Comments (12)
I have created a test issue in fork repo so that I can add the issuehunt fund there.
https://github.com/deliverymanager/cordova-plugin-media-capture/issues
@Mapiac feel free to increase the fund in order to attract a developer that will spend the time to add this feature.
Note: This feature will be merged to the original so that it will be available to everyone.
from cordova-plugin-media-capture.
+1
from cordova-plugin-media-capture.
Motivation Behind Feature
@Mapiac
How can we motivate to add this feature?
from cordova-plugin-media-capture.
Pay someone to implement it. Or wait until someone comes along that wants to do this for free.
from cordova-plugin-media-capture.
@janpio Instead of paying someone externally, how do you recommend finding some contributor in this project to pay him?
Is there a standard way or a recommended one?
There might be more than one that need this new feature and would be willing to pay a one or more developers in order to create the feature.
I just believe it is better that more than one person pays for that new feature so that more than one person can enjoy it.
from cordova-plugin-media-capture.
The most probable way to find someone would be to find the people willing to pay first, combine the individual willingness to pay into an offer, and then e.g. post to the dev mailing list linked at https://cordova.apache.org/contact/ with a concrete offer - or just post it here.
(This plugin hasn't seen real development for ages, so it won't be easy to find anyone with a lot of experience with it.)
I just believe it is better that more than one person pays for that new feature so that more than one person can enjoy it.
If I develop features for Open Source software for someone, my default contract includes that the developed feature will be open sourced as well. You pay for it, but everybody can use it afterwards. Of course not everybody likes that, but π€·ββ
from cordova-plugin-media-capture.
I really believe that if for example this new feature would cost $200 in order to be able to develop it, we would find 5 persons that would like to offer $40 to have the feature even though it would not be an exclusive feature.
Honestly, why do you think this so important plugin is not well maintained?
And do you think there should be a way to support this plugin by the people that are actually willing to contribute one way or another?
I have made another post #137 about it but do you think it is possible to put the plugin for example on issuehunt or any other same platform in order to support it?
from cordova-plugin-media-capture.
I really believe that if for example this new feature would cost $200 in order to be able to develop it, we would find 5 persons that would like to offer $40 to have the feature even though it would not be an exclusive feature.
Feel free to try that, but an open source issues tracker then is not the right place to discuss this.
Honestly, why do you think this so important plugin is not well maintained?
Because it means there are no developers that know the current codebase without having to look at it first.
And do you think there should be a way to support this plugin by the people that are actually willing to contribute one way or another?
This is an Open Source project from the Apache Software Foundation. To contribute start at https://cordova.apache.org/contribute/, if you want to/can spend some money look at http://www.apache.org/foundation/sponsorship.html
I have made another post #137 about it but do you think it is possible to put the plugin for example on issuehunt or any other same platform in order to support it?
This is offtopic to this issue (Apache Software Foundation and the Apache Cordova project do not use Issuehunt.) - please keep the discussion about @Mapiac's issue.
from cordova-plugin-media-capture.
Of course I am not talking about supporting Apache Software Foundation and I am not a millionaire...
I just honestly try to figure out a way in order to be able to support as much as I am able to do it, this plugin that I really think is so important in app development.
I have been using cordova for so so many years and it hurts my feelings to see other plugins like the
https://github.com/react-native-community/react-native-camera
to have been able to evolve because there were contributors that would be willing to pay some bucks and would have the ability to do it so that they could support the developers.
@Mapiac what's your opinion? Would you create a bounty to be able to have this open source feature available?
@janpio If I create a fork and then use for example issuehunt to create a bounty for the new feature, and then make pull requests to the original project in order to have the new feature available to the source? Do you think this is a doable plan?
from cordova-plugin-media-capture.
If I create a fork and then use for example issuehunt to create a bounty for the new feature, and then make pull requests to the original project in order to have the new feature available to the source? Do you think this is a doable plan?
If the feature doesn't break any existing functionality and is well designed, we well may accept that pull request. But even otherwise, your fork would then have this functionality and people wanting it could use it. So that would be great!
from cordova-plugin-media-capture.
Hi @deliverymanager that sounds like a great plan I would support that fork (or pull request) 100%. We will pay up to $40 with input
from cordova-plugin-media-capture.
@janpio Is it possible to add a flag to the issue like "Bounty" or "Funded by member" so that we might catch the attention of some developer?
from cordova-plugin-media-capture.
Related Issues (20)
- Plugins are missing dependencies HOT 1
- Get frame(s) from Video stream
- Vite Rollup Error using plugin in react vite app HOT 1
- Android permission denied When opening the camera HOT 10
- Provide the ability to store capture files in private app storage rather than external storage HOT 6
- when i set duration 15sοΌit not work in HarmonyOs
- Types of parameters 'data' and 'value' are incompatible HOT 1
- Recording interface is broken HOT 4
- Can anything be done at all about the extremely ugly and awkward audio recording UI on IOS? HOT 2
- Android 13 support Targetting SDK 33 HOT 8
- Version 5.0.0 requires Android 12 and Node 16 HOT 5
- On android 13 api level 33 plugin gives permission denied error HOT 1
- App crashes on Android 13 when starts recording a video HOT 1
- cordova-plugin-media-capture video not working android 13 HOT 7
- [Android] Support "partial access to photos and videos" for devices running Android 14 HOT 1
- [Android] Remove broad photo/video permissions and use a system picker - Google Play Policy deadline 2024-08 HOT 2
- Cant get access to media file HOT 3
- Can't take photo on Android 8, 9, 10 when another photo application is installed HOT 2
- i am using Media-Capture plugin to record video and upload to server, video recording is successfully working and receive MediaFiles[], but how i convert to blob file for uploading video to server
- i am using Media-Capture plugin to record video and upload to server, video recording is successfully working and receive MediaFiles[], but how i convert to blob file for uploading video to server, i tried many solution but none of working for me H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
π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. πππ
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google β€οΈ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from cordova-plugin-media-capture.